在打算机编程中,函数初始化是一个关键步调,它为函数的运转打下基本。简单来说,函数初始化就是为函数设置初始状况跟须要资本的过程。 具体而言,函数初始化重要包含多少个方面:起首是定义函数的参数跟前去值范例,这决定了函数的输入输出情势;其次是设置函数外部变量的初始值,确保在函数履行前,这些变量有一个断定的初始状况;再次是分配须要的内存空间,尤其是对那些须要静态分配内存的函数。 其余,初始化还可能包含对函数外部数据构造的构建,如初始化一个列表或创建一个类的实例。对一些复杂的函数,可能还须要停止错误检查跟异常处理机制的设置,以进步顺序的结实性。 在函数初始化过程中,公道的初始化次序至关重要。不恰当的初始化次序可能招致资本竞争、内存泄漏乃至顺序崩溃。因此,编写函数时,开辟者须要细心打算初始化的逻辑次序。 总结来说,函数初始化为函数的履行供给了须要的情况跟前提。它是编程中不容忽视的一环,关联到顺序的牢固性跟效力。